Purchasing Power Analysis
A Aerospace Engineers in California earns $105,000 in nominal terms, which is 11% above the national average of $94,630.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$75,812 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.

How much does a Aerospace Engineers make in California?
The median Aerospace Engineers salary in California is $105,000 based on 491 DOL filings.
Is California a good place to work as a Aerospace Engineers?
A Aerospace Engineers in California earns 11% more than the national median of $94,630, or $75,812 after adjusting for the local cost of living.
